Evidence: n. atlantic sediments (ice rafted debris) and heinrich events. Episodes of higher than normal iceberg presence in n. atlantic recorded based on ice rafted debris found in ocean sediments. Heinrich events occurred at same time as cold air temperature in greenland, but not during every cold event. Evidence: greenland ice cores and sediments in n. atlantic ocean + foram species. Changes in polar (cold water) surface foram species abundance in n. atlantic ocean sediments in sync with greenland ice core air temperature shifts. Ratio of certain alkenones (lipids or fats) in plankton depends on temperature in which they grow (in lab and field) Plankton can adjust saturated v. unsaturated fats: cold = (cid:373)ore u(cid:374)saturated fats so they do(cid:374)(cid:859)t get too rigid. Measure alkenone ratio on plankton remains in sediments. Assume modern relationship holds in past to estimate sea.
